What are the best landmarks to visit in the Philippines?
The Philippines boasts incredible landmarks. For history buffs, Intramuros in Manila, a walled city dating back to the Spanish colonial era, is a must-see. The Banaue Rice Terraces in Ifugao province are breathtaking, a UNESCO World Heritage Site showcasing ancient farming techniques. Chocolate Hills in Bohol are a unique geological formation, while the stunning Puerto Princesa Subterranean River National Park in Palawan offers an unforgettable cave exploration experience.

What are some must-do activities in the Philippines?
Island hopping is a quintessential Philippine experience. Explore the turquoise waters and white-sand beaches of El Nido or Coron in Palawan. Diving or snorkelling in Tubbataha Reefs Natural Park, another UNESCO World Heritage Site, is a must for underwater enthusiasts. For a cultural immersion, visit a local market, try cooking classes featuring Filipino cuisine, or experience a traditional dance performance.
The best time to visit generally falls during the dry season, from November to May. However, the weather varies regionally. The northern areas experience cooler temperatures during this period, whilst the south tends to be hot and sunny. Typhoon season runs from June to October, so it's advisable to check weather forecasts before travelling during these months.

Is renting a car recommended for exploring the Philippines?
Renting a car can be challenging in the Philippines due to traffic congestion in major cities and the condition of some roads. Public transport, such as jeepneys and tricycles, is widely available and often a more convenient and cost-effective option, particularly for shorter distances. For longer journeys or exploring more remote areas, hiring a driver is recommended.

Are credit cards widely accepted in the Philippines?
Credit card acceptance is becoming more common in larger cities and tourist areas, but cash remains king. It's advisable to carry sufficient Philippine pesos, especially in smaller towns and rural areas, as many smaller establishments may not accept credit cards.
What are the largest airports in the Philippines?
The Ninoy Aquino International Airport (MNL) in Manila is the main international gateway. Other significant airports include Mactan-Cebu International Airport (CEB) in Cebu and Francisco B. Reyes Airport (Clark International Airport) in Angeles City.
Are there any unwritten rules of behaviour visitors should know about the Philippines?
Filipinos are generally very hospitable and respectful. Showing respect for elders is crucial. It's polite to remove your shoes before entering someone's home. Avoid public displays of affection. And, learning a few basic Tagalog phrases will be greatly appreciated.
What local specialties should you try in the Philippines?
Adobo, a dish of meat braised in soy sauce, vinegar, garlic, and peppercorns, is a national favourite. Sinigang, a sour and savoury soup, is another must-try. Lechon, a whole roasted pig, is a popular celebratory dish. Halo-halo, a refreshing dessert made with shaved ice, sweet beans, fruits, and milk, is perfect for the hot weather.
Where are the best shopping spots in the Philippines?
Greenbelt Mall and SM Mall of Asia in Manila are large shopping malls with a wide variety of goods. Ayala Center Cebu offers a similar high-end shopping experience in Cebu City. For more local crafts and souvenirs, explore the many markets throughout the country.
What signature events or festivals take place in the Philippines?
The Sinulog Festival in Cebu City is a vibrant celebration held every January. The Panagbenga Flower Festival in Baguio City is a spectacular display of flowers in February. MassKara Festival in Bacolod City is known for its colourful masks and parades.
What’s the best place in the Philippines for mild and comfortable weather?
Baguio City, located in the mountains of Luzon, offers a consistently mild and comfortable climate throughout the year, making it a popular escape from the tropical heat.
What are the most common travel mistakes tourists make in the Philippines?
Underestimating travel times between islands, not exchanging currency before arriving, and failing to plan for potential typhoons are common mistakes. Also, neglecting to research local customs and traditions can lead to unintentional cultural faux pas.
What are some hidden gems to explore in the Philippines?
The Hundred Islands National Park in Pangasinan offers secluded beaches and stunning scenery. Siargao Island is a surfer's paradise with pristine beaches and lush landscapes. Mount Apo in Davao is the highest peak in the country, offering incredible trekking opportunities.
